R. v. Cleveland Collection Decisions of the Court of Appeal Date 2004-01-23 Docket numbers C40126 Judges Doherty, David H.; Rosenberg, Marc; Moldaver, Michael James Subject Criminal Decision Content DATE: 20040123 DOCKET: C40126 COURT OF APPEAL FOR ONTARIO RE: HER MAJESTY THE QUEEN (Respondent) - and - RICHARD ROLAND CLEVELAND (Appellant) BEFORE: DOHERTY, ROSENBERG and MOLDAVER JJ.A. COUNSEL: Robert M. Geurts for the appellant Leslie Paine for the respondent HEARD & ENDORSED: January 21, 2004 On appeal from the sentence of Justice Antonio Di Zio of the Ontario Court of Justice dated May 7, 2003. APPEAL BOOK ENDORSEMENT [1] Counsel is unable to reach his client. The appeal is dismissed as an abandoned appeal.
